unbelievably

 
Adverbial unbelievably has 2 senses
  1. incredibly, improbably, implausibly, unbelievably - not easy to believe; "behind you the coastal hills plunge to the incredibly blue sea backed by the Turkish mountains"
    Antonyms: believably
    Derived from adjective unbelievable1
  2. unbelievably - in an unbelievable manner; "he was unbelievably angry"
    Antonyms:
    believably
    Derived from adjective unbelievable1
